Start running cool water over the skin
Running cool water over the burned skin, when the skin is burned, keep your burned part under the water for at least ten minutes until your burned area will be cooled. If you find it is not cooled then continue your burned area under the running water.
Using first aid technique
If your burned areas have cooled but it is still painful then it is better to take a pain reliever that contains anti-inflammatory properties that relieve pain. Clean your burned area with cool water and make sure to pat instead of rubbing, otherwise, it can cause damage to your skin. If your skin is blistered then make sure to not even pat.
